Navigating Trump's Tariff Onslaught
The United States, under President Donald Trump, imposed significant tariff pressures on multiple trading partners, creating a challenging environment for global commerce. India, as a major emerging economy, found itself at the crossroads of these economic tensions. Ambassador Sajjanhar highlighted that instead of engaging in public confrontations, India adopted a strategy of calm and calculated silence. This approach allowed New Delhi to assess the situation thoroughly without escalating diplomatic friction.
India's response was not one of passivity but of strategic restraint, ensuring that national interests remained paramount over short-term political alliances. The discussion emphasized how this silence was a deliberate tactic to avoid being drawn into the broader credibility crisis facing American foreign policy at the time.
Diversifying Partnerships and Securing Autonomy
A key theme of the dialogue was India's proactive efforts to diversify its international partnerships. This involved negotiating mega trade deals with various nations and regions, reducing dependency on any single country. Energy choices and access to critical minerals were identified as vital components of this strategy, as India sought to secure resources essential for its economic and technological growth.
The shifting global alignments, with emerging powers and changing alliances, presented both opportunities and risks. India's diplomacy focused on safeguarding its strategic autonomy, ensuring that it could make independent decisions without undue external influence. This balancing act was described as walking a razor's edge in global power politics, where missteps could have significant repercussions.
